Do not believe the ads that Allstate auto insurance is so great; cheaper than many others, yes... to start with. They say they won't cancel your insurance if you have a claim but I can tell you from personal experience that is false. I had a fender bender and they dropped me instantly. Lots of people think that's not a big deal, it is. When that happens and you go to the next company you're in for a surprise because once Allstate drops you, you have then been "denied insurance before" to your next company and you will either be denied insurance or you'll be classified as an ultra high risk insured and you'll pay through the nose. As an example, I paid 835 a year with Allstate. After they cancelled me, it cost me 2800 a year for 6 years after Allstate. Be very careful people.

If you have an auto quote and request a quote for a replacement or additional vehicle, they will quote you from that day until your existing renewal date. They will not tell you this nor inform you of this in any way, shape, or form until your renewal comes due. You then find out that the quote was for 4 or 6 or whatever months and not for 12 months insurance as you had mistakenly assumed. Totally unethical! Furthermore, they charge you in full for the change immediately (before you catch on to their deception) and then take the new renewal amount from your bank on a date other than your regular withdrawal date. The entire scam is all legal, and very carefully worked out to essentially sell you product that you would never agree to having known the facts.
